You Can See the Living Soul of the Gem

The phrase “once in a blue moon” spoke of the rare event of two full moons in a calendar month. The moon does cast a blueish light. The blue glow is seen especially well in the winter above snowy fields. Moonstone can occur in several shades. Blue is the best, and crystal clear is the most rare and most desirable.

This is a blue moonstone because it has an apparition of blue light, which hovers at the crest of the gem and moves ghost-like across its surface as you move or as the gem moves. This phenomenon allows you to see the living soul of the stone as light drifts through. The gem’s life rising to the surface hoovers at the stones highest points.

Moonstone is nature’s crystal ball. It’s actually better. If crystal balls could, they would be made of moonstone. No natural moonstone has ever been large enough. Why is this gem magical? Because it possesses a phenomenon called adularescence. It glows with a blueish white light and has a ghostly aura of blue that seemingly floats above the gem. Its hovering blue-white glow challenges the eye because you, the wearer could easily be convinced that the light is floating, hovering above like a ghostly Will o’ Wisp.
